Dimetric, trimetric, oblique, triangular: from Advanced tab's Grid type option in Grid and Axis Manager.įor any axonometric grids, planes can be switched between so you can apply in-plane transforms on front, side and top planes in turn.Trimetric left and isometric (with planes): as presets from Grid and Axis Manager.Isometric (with planes): Easy setup via the Isometric panel.Perspective projections are not supported in Affinity.Īffinity Designer lets you set up different types of grid in different ways: This means that grid lines never converge to a vanishing point as in perspective projections. Isometric and other axonometric grids are, by nature, parallel projections. Isometric and axonometric grids Isometric and axonometric gridsĪffinity Designer makes use of highly customizable isometric and other axonometric grids, perfect for UI/game design, digital design models, mock ups or designs which benefit from this style. ![]()
